    GST A Unit Test 2026 End, Check Question

    By Education DeskApril 10, 2026 12:34 PMUpdated:April 10, 2026 12:38 PM
    GST A Unit Question 2026

    The ‘A’ Unit admission test under the General, Science and Technology (GST) cluster system ended across Bangladesh on Friday. The exam took place on April 10 from 11:00 AM to 12:00 PM at 21 centres nationwide.

    As per the official report, a total of 166,102 candidates applied for the science stream this year. Officials confirmed that the test followed a multiple-choice question format with a total of 100 marks. The minimum pass mark was set at 30. For each wrong answer, 0.25 marks will be deducted.

    This exam marks the end of the GST cluster admission process for the 2025–2026 academic year. In total, 284,480 students applied to 20 public universities under this system. Among them, 166,162 applied for the ‘A’ Unit, 93,102 for the ‘B’ Unit, and 25,185 for the ‘C’ Unit.

    Authorities instructed candidates to arrive at least one hour before the exam. Students were required to carry their admit cards and necessary documents for entry.

    Earlier, the ‘C’ Unit test was held on March 27, with results published on March 29. The ‘B’ Unit exam took place on April 3, and results were released on April 6.

    The GST system allows students to apply to multiple universities through a single exam. Authorities are expected to announce the ‘A’ Unit results in the coming days.
